How I got my first client

First things first, I started writing without waiting for anyone to acknowledge me.

This meant I wrote a book way before I knew ghostwriting books existed as a profession.

I also started my daily blog writing one small blog a day. Just because I wanted to build my muscle of writing.

But then let’s be honest, you cannot just sit around and wait for clients to come to you.

So I looked up “companies in Noida” online, checked their websites, and figured who needed a blog on their website. Then I just reached out to them. I typed “Noida” because a part of me wanted to visit people in person. This is not applicable now, because you can cold email anyone across the globe.

Applied to multiple. Then got a referral to write a blog. Which paid peanuts, but nonetheless, I got a client. That was more important.
